After the Jamaican artist dropped a diss towards the producer's past flame, she had some harsher words for her non-diss single.

The baby mama drama involving star producer London On Da Track continues. After his ex-flame Shenseea got into some beef with Eboni, who alleged that Shenseea's son got inappropriate with Eboni's daughter, the former released somewhat of a diss track against her. Of course, London doesn't exactly have the best reputation as a baby daddy, as Summer Walker also aired out her frustrations with the Memphis-born and Atlanta-raised hitmaker. However, all this drama is playing out in dramatic fashion when it comes to music. Eboni just took to Instagram to diss Shenseea's new single "Curious."

"'Curious' 2 know what type of cornballs listen to Chinchilla anyways," she wrote on her Instagram Story, and continued her attacks in various posts. With this message, Eboni absolutely blasted Shenseea and doubled down on a lot of her claims, while also going into further detail surrounding their spat. However, London On Da Track himself hopped in the comments section of The Shade Room's coverage calling cap on these allegations.

"Fukry gettin old give it up," the producer wrote. "Won't be the first lie won't be the last... get a life n move on with it... NEXT." To be fair, he might be referring to the media itself, but it's still quite the complicated web he weaved with all of this.
